Atropos Sextile Imum Coeli

Opportunities to bring old wounds and unfinished family matters to a gentle close keep appearing if you take them. A conversation with a relative, a ritual of letting go, a quiet act of forgiveness can each settle something at your roots. Nothing forces this, so the healing belongs to the version of you that chooses to reach for it.
